How to Get Through Airport Security Quickly

Airport security is one of the most stressful aspects of traveling. With constantly changing restrictions and procedures, passing through a TSA checkpoint is even more frustrating than dealing with security elsewhere. Follow these steps to minimize the disruption to your travel schedule, and get through airport security quickly.
First: Know what is and is not allowed
Check with the TSA online to make sure that you know which items are and are not allowed past security. Take care when you pack to leave sharp objects, liquids, gels, weapons, items which resemble weapons and all other prohibited items at home.
Second: Have documents ready
As you approach the security checkpoint, make sure that you have your boarding pass and identification ready to present to the screeners to expedite passage through to the scanning stations. Scope out the scanners as you approach, and choose the shortest line. Avoid lines with families and heavily-laden travelers to move as quickly as possible.
Third: Know procedures and prepare early
As you get in line at the security checkpoint, make sure you and your baggage are ready to pass. If required, place approved liquids in a plastic bag and place it in a bin. Remove shoes, outer clothing and metal accessories, placing them into the bins. Place laptops in bins by themselves. Follow any screener instructions and signage as you approach the checkpoint and while you are waiting in line to avoid delays at the scanner.
Fourth: Reclaim items and move ahead
Once you pass through the scanner, reclaim your baggage quickly and move out of the way to put on your shoes and outer clothing.
